Central test reporting system EMS before breakdown

According to the Ministry of Health, the epidemiological reporting system (EMS), in which the official corona test results from all over Austria are collected centrally, threatens to collapse due to overload. The dynamics of the fourth wave are currently leading to an “unprecedented number of test results”, which poses an “acute challenge” for the EMS, according to the APA ministry in the evening.

Only report positive cases

“To prevent the EMS from collapsing, the Ministry of Health has instructed federal states and laboratories to only register people with positive test results in the EMS from now on,” the APA said on Thursday evening. Negative test results and suspected cases may not be reported until further notice. Instead, they should be processed using the state’s own systems.

This measure affects Vienna, Lower Austria, Upper Austria, Salzburg, Tyrol and Vorarlberg. Styria, Carinthia and Burgenland are excluded “due to other technical requirements”. The “emergency measure” will remain in place until it can be determined that the EMS remains “sufficiently efficient” due to the decreasing number of cases, it said.
